장고(django)에서 마크다운(markdown) 적용하는 방법

장고의 포스트 모델이 단일 텍스트 필드라서 새로운 문서 에디터라도 넣어야되나 싶었다. 관련된 내용을 인터넷에서 찾아보니 깃허브에서 텍스트를 마크다운으로 변환해주는 API를 제공해 주는데, 글을 작성한 분께서는 requests를 이용하였다. 텍스트를 주고 HTML을...

PHP에서 Ajax 사용하는 방법

사실은 Ajax에서 PHP를 사용하는 방법이 맞지만 카테고리가 PHP이므로… 여하간 오늘 처음으로 Ajax를 사용했는데 정말 좋다. 이 방식을 이용하면 실시간 통신도 쉽게 구현할 수 있을 것 같다. 물론 성능은 고려하지 않고...

2019년도 정보처리기사 1회 필기/실기 합격

다행히 원하던대로 1회차에 필기와 실기를 모두 합격할 수 있었다. 이번에 공부를 해보니 다른 자격증도 뭔가 쉽게 딸 수 있을 것 같은(?) 생각이 들었다. 이 글에서는 필자가 얼마나 공부했고 어떤식으로 공부했고...

파이썬 그래프 그리는 방법

그래프는 생각보다 사용할 일이 다분한 것 같다. 필자가 진행하고 있는 프로젝트에도 필요하여 사용법을 찾아 보았다. 결과를 실시간으로 그려보고 싶었지만 스레딩이 필요한지 안되는 관계로 출력된 파일에서 필요한 부분만 잘라서 그래프로 그려보고자...

유니티 / 파이썬 소켓 통신

유니티와 파이썬을 연동할 수 있는 방법을 모색하였다.

유니티 오브젝트 동적 생성

오브젝트를 생성했다가 생성한 오브젝트를 제거하고 다시 오브젝트를 생성하는 방법을 사용해야 했는데, 기본적으로 생성한 오브젝트를 사용하여 파괴한 경우 다시 생성하는 방법을 알 수 없어 일단은 복제하는 방법으로 오브젝트를 동적으로 생성하는 방법을...

구름IDE(Goorm IDE) VNC/noVNC

안정인님께서 만들어 놓으신 스크립트를 사용하여 구름 IDE에서 VNC 서버와, noVNC(?) 서버를 정말 뚝딱 만들 수 있었다. 프로젝트는 빈 프로젝트(14.04 LTS)를 사용하였다.

유니티 1인칭 카메라 스크립트

유니티를 간만에 사용할 일이 생겼는데 간만에 하니까 정말 아무것도 기억이 안났다. 물론 간보듯이 살짝 해본게 가장 큰 문제였겠지만… 여튼간에 다시 사용해 본 김에 제대로 다시 공부하고 공부한 내용을 기록해 놓으려고...

라즈베리파이(RaspberryPi) PyQt5 설치 방법

파이썬에서 GUI를 구현하는 방법으로는 tkinter를 사용하거나 PyQt를 사용하는 방법이 있다. PyQt는 디자인 툴이 있어서 레이아웃 설계가 상당히 편리하다.

Nginx 주로 사용하는 기능들 정리

Nginx는 C언어와 유사한 문법을 통해서 웹서버를 유연하게 다룰 수 있다. 필자는 Nginx에 대하여 완벽하게 문법을 이해하고 있는 상태는 아니지만, 몇몇의 자주 사용하게 되는 기능들을 정리해 놓고자 한다. 이건 필자가 주로...

윈도우 cmd, 파워쉘에서 cl 명령어

vs 개발자 명령 프롬프트의 실행속도가 너무 느려서(켜지는 속도를 말하는게 아니라 동작 가능한 상태가 되기까지의 시간을 의미한다) 파워쉘에 cl 명령어등을 등록해서 사용할 생각이었다. 파워쉘에 리눅스 명령도 그대로 사용할 수 있고 넘넘...

리눅스 백그라운드 실행

ssh에 접속하여 장고를 실행시킨 후 ssh를 종료하면 당연히 장고 서버도 꺼진다. 리눅스에서 실행시킬때 마지막에 &를 붙이면 백그라운드 재생이 되길래 시도했지만 장고에선 먹히지 않았다. 아마도 로그 기록이 남아야해서 그런듯 싶다.